On the training side, things are really hotting up with courses quickly filling up. One of the most popular is the RYA VHF DSC course. A radio is an essential safety tool but knowing how to use it is equally important. In fact, if you don’t hold a certificate you are only legally entitled to use the radio for emergencies.
